Output d4a88b3ae7197c690447e7494293ec78af7054d51daf356b0313e00371d5c445:14

value
20416699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0bc2dad24a4101c0f339b786ba0e74a55d0c8ca OP_EQUAL
address
3GLuU6ugLpjupiqFdajzqSW6cxR6kjhuYb
transaction
d4a88b3ae7197c690447e7494293ec78af7054d51daf356b0313e00371d5c445
spent
false

23 Sat Ranges